The ARMv8 NEON codec for MX Player 1.49.0 is an essential third-party add-on designed to restore high-definition audio support to the popular Android media player. Due to licensing restrictions, native support for advanced audio formats like EAC3 (Dolby Digital Plus), DTS, and TrueHD is often missing from the base application, necessitating a manual "custom codec" installation. The Role of ARMv8 NEON Architecture
The "ARMv8" designation refers to the 64-bit instruction set used by most modern smartphones and tablets. The NEON technology within these processors is a SIMD (Single Instruction, Multiple Data) architecture that accelerates signal processing. Using a codec specifically optimized for this hardware allows MX Player to:
Enable Silent Audio: Fix the common "EAC3 audio format not supported" error.
Boost Performance: Leverage multi-core decoding for smoother 4K/8K video playback.

A codec (coder-decoder) is a piece of software that compresses or decompresses digital video. MX Player uses custom codec packs to handle formats that your device’s native hardware decoder cannot manage. Common examples include AC3 (Dolby Digital), DTS (Digital Theater Systems), MLP, and certain FLAC or high-bitrate HEVC files.

To install the ARMv8 NEON custom codec for MX Player version 1.49.0, follow these steps to enable support for audio formats like EAC3, AC3, and DTS . 1. Identify and Download the Correct Codec
MX Player requires a codec that matches your device architecture and the specific version of the app .
Check Requirements: Open MX Player, go to Settings > Decoder, and scroll to the bottom. Look at the Custom codec field to confirm it asks for "ARMv8 NEON" .
Get the File: Download the aio-1.49.0-build_2.zip (All-in-One) or the specific neon64-1.49.0 file from a trusted repository like Free-Codecs or WinXDVD .
Storage: Keep the downloaded .zip file in your device’s Downloads folder or internal storage . 2. Installation Guide You can install the codec either automatically or manually. Automatic Method: Open MX Player . armv8 neon codec for mx player 1490 top
If the .zip file is in your internal storage, the app should automatically detect it and ask, "Use [codec name] custom codec?" . Tap OK. The app will restart and apply the new codec . Manual Method:
Open MX Player and tap the three dots (Menu) in the top-right corner . Navigate to Settings > Decoder . Scroll to the bottom and tap Custom codec .
Navigate to the folder where you saved the .zip file and select it .
MX Player will restart automatically. If it doesn't, close and reopen the app manually . 3. Verify the Installation To ensure the codec is active:
Go to Help > About within MX Player. It should list the version and mention that the custom codec is loaded .
Try playing a video that previously had no sound or displayed an "EAC3 not supported" error; it should now play with full audio . Troubleshooting
"Can't find custom codec": Ensure you haven't renamed the .zip file, as the app specifically looks for the version number in the filename (e.g., 1.49.0) .
Permission Issues: On newer Android versions, ensure MX Player has "Files and Media" permissions set to Always to access the codec file .
